In addition, some shampoos contain ingredients like minoxidil, ketoconazole, or biotin, which can help improve the appearance of hair and scalp health. These ingredients may be effective in reducing hair loss and promoting thicker hair, though their effectiveness can vary from person to person. Consistency in usage is crucial for achieving optimal results.

Overall, while there is no guaranteed solution to hair fall, anti-hair fall shampoos can be a helpful addition to a comprehensive hair care routine.
